Our two California Airedale Terriers:
Annie is 5 years old and Teddy is 9 weeks old.
Already, at 11 weeks old, Teddy weighed in at 25 pounds! Usually, as Airedales get older, their growth rates goes down and most of the time they reach their full growth at a year to 18 months. Read more

Teddy & Annie at 8 weeks old and 5 years old for Annie. Airedale Terrier puppies are real bundles of energy. They love to play, roughhouse and naturally get into mischief. At eight weeks old, their little teeth are like razors. Even though they’re just playing, you’re lucky to get a couple of days without getting a little puncture wound on your hand, your arm or your lower leg.
We tried to keep a lot of toys around for Teddy to keep them occupied and out of trouble. Well, perhaps I should say how to big trouble, because you can never keep an Airedale puppy completely out of trouble. It seems there’s always an article of clothing a pair of slippers or a newspaper that’s attacked by Teddy on a daily basis. I think the fact that he’s playing more and more with Annie these days, is keeping them out of real trouble. Read more
